Web15 sep. 2024 · To find your child's adjusted age, count the number of weeks between their birth date and their due date, and subtract that amount of time from their current age. For example, if you have a 4-month-old baby who was born 8 weeks early, their adjusted age would be 4 months minus 8 weeks, which comes to about 2 months. WebThe immature brain continues to develop even after the time of birth. The more prematurely the baby is born, the more likely it is that bleeding or other signs of stress will affect the brain. Even at 35 weeks, the baby's brain weighs only two-thirds what it will weigh at term (about 40 weeks). Web11 jan. 2024 · The risk is much lower from babies born even at 35 weeks. But late preterm babies are still at risk for: respiratory distress syndrome (RDS) sepsis patent ductus arteriosus (PDA) jaundice...

Babies born at 37 and 38 weeks at higher risk for adverse health outcomes. Summary: Babies considered "early-term," born at 37 or 38 weeks after a mother's last menstrual period, may look as healthy as full-term babies born at 39-41 weeks, but a study has found that many of them are not.

WebPreterm Birth. Preterm birth is when a baby is born too early, before 37 weeks of pregnancy have been completed. In 2024, preterm birth affected about 1 of every 10 infants born in the United States.
